Mediating Multiple Generative-AI Tools in Academic Work

Abstract: | As generative AI (GenAI) tools become increasingly embedded in academic workflows, academics are not only becoming users of individual systems but also learning to interact with and navigate multiple platforms that have different capabilities, limitations, and epistemic assumptions. This thesis explores how academic users mediate between multiple GenAI systems in their knowledge work. Using qualitative data from 12 semi-structured interviews with academics, the study applies the Gioia methodology to develop a grounded model of GenAI orchestration. Four aggregate dimensions were identified: frictions in interfacing with GenAI, tactics for coordinating tools, strategic mediation and transformational learning and identity. These were linked through three underlying mechanisms: epistemic calibration, delegation as coping and value-driven bricolage. These mechanisms reveal how users adapt to uncertainty, manage overload and align GenAI practices with personal and pedagogical values. The study presents a dynamic, non-linear model of GenAi integration that foregrounds user agency, reflective adaptation and contextual negotiation. These findings offer conceptual insight into how GenAI can reshape academic practice and identity, with implications for pedagogy and tool design in higher education. |
